NBA Playoffs -- Cavaliers favored to win 2015 NBA title
By Raymund Rondobio PhilBoxing.com Sat, 18 Apr 2015

After a tough 82-game regular season schedule that spanned from October 28, 2014 to April 15, 2015, the NBA playoffs are finally here with 16 out of the 30 teams making the post-season cut.
The Golden State Warriors finished as the No.1 seed in the Western Conference while the Atlanta Hawks are the top seeds in the Eastern Conference with a 60-22 card. By virtue of their franchise-best 67-15 slate, the Warriors hold home court advantage throughout the West playoffs and into the NBA Finals.
But a No.2 seed in the East -- the Cleveland Cavaliers --- are favored to win the Larry O'Brien trophy, according to the Westgate SuperBook in Las Vegas. With their Big 3 of LeBron James, Kyrie Irving and Kevin Love, the Cavs are favorites with a 9-4 odds.
The Warriors, with the sweet-shooting MVP candidate Steph Curry at the forefront, is second with 5-2 odds.
At third are the San Antonio Spurs with 5-2 odds. Th Spurs are a modest sixth seed in the Western Conference with a 55-27 record. But the defending champions finished regular season play on a spectacular note, winning 12 of their last 13 games.
The Bulls, who had an up-and-down season filled with injuries to various players, most notably former MVP Derrick Rose, were pegged at 14-1. Chicago is the No.3 seed in the East and Rose had just recently returned from a torn meniscus surgery.
If Rose's good health holds up, the Bulls can make a real deep playoffs run, and quite possibly, win it all.
Two of the league's storied franchises didn't make the playoffs this spring. No thanks to a torn rotator cuff that sidelined Kobe Bryant for 47 games, the Los Angeles Lakers limped with team-worst 21-61 record and out of post-season contention.
The New York Knicks also lost their star -- Carmelo Anthony -- to 42 games and struggled mightily, before salvaging 17 wins in a dark season tainted with 65 defeats.
